If a rectangle has length p and width p - 4, what is the perimeter of the rectangle in terms of p?
12p - 8
2p - 4
4p - 8
4p - 4

Answer:

4p - 8.

Step-by-step explanation:

Perimeter = 2* length + 2 * width

=   2p + 2(p - 4)

= 4p - 8.
